nfs: Panic when commit fails
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Actually pass the NFS_FILE_SYNC option to the server to avoid a
Panic in nfs_direct_write_complete() when a commit fails.

At the end of an nfs write, if the nfs commit fails, all the writes
will be rescheduled.  They are supposed to be rescheduled as NFS_FILE_SYNC
writes, but the rpc_task structure is not completely intialized and so
the option is not passed.  When the rescheduled writes complete, the
return indicates that they are NFS_UNSTABLE and we try to do another
commit.  This leads to a Panic because the commit data structure pointer
was set to null in the initial (failed) commit attempt.
